diff options
author | Hans Petter Selasky <hselasky@FreeBSD.org> | 2020-12-19 11:03:54 +0000 |
---|---|---|
committer | Hans Petter Selasky <hselasky@FreeBSD.org> | 2020-12-19 11:03:54 +0000 |
commit | 7d0368ee3403378806dce84cb31b9a0cc389258d (patch) | |
tree | 105d4918a8b7e3adafa8e2ce42a1ad0549123110 /sys/dev | |
parent | 226f43e757ff7a0f945f9deb0fb1481a752274bc (diff) | |
download | src-test2-7d0368ee3403378806dce84cb31b9a0cc389258d.tar.gz src-test2-7d0368ee3403378806dce84cb31b9a0cc389258d.zip |
Notes
Diffstat (limited to 'sys/dev')
-rw-r--r-- | sys/dev/usb/net/if_ure.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/sys/dev/usb/net/if_ure.c b/sys/dev/usb/net/if_ure.c index d552f2c69f56..2be46371cd28 100644 --- a/sys/dev/usb/net/if_ure.c +++ b/sys/dev/usb/net/if_ure.c @@ -711,7 +711,7 @@ ure_bulk_read_callback(struct usb_xfer *xfer, usb_error_t error) goto tr_setup; } - if (len != 0) + if (len >= (ETHER_HDR_LEN + ETHER_CRC_LEN)) m = ure_makembuf(pc, off, len - ETHER_CRC_LEN); else m = NULL; |